How Much Does a Private ADHD Diagnosis Cost?

top-doctors-logo.pngIf you are an adult who suffers from ADHD you may have to pursue a private adhd assessment plymouth path to get diagnosed. This is a good alternative, since many private adhd assessment ipswich psychiatrists have experience in diagnosing ADHD in adults. They will also screen them for co-morbidities like anxiety and depression that are common among this group.

Psychiatrist fees

The fees of a psychiatrist make up significant proportion of the total cost when someone is diagnosed as having ADHD. The fees include the time and expertise of the psychiatrist as well as the medical report and the prescribed medication. Psychiatrists charge for overheads and administrative expenses, including the office staff. Before making a choice it is crucial to understand the total cost. The best way to know the fees is to speak with an expert in your area.

In the UK only psychiatrists are qualified to diagnose ADHD. This is vital, as the condition can be hard to recognize, particularly in adults. During an evaluation psychiatrist will take into consideration a variety of factors, such as the family history and symptoms. The psychiatrist will ask about your personal and professional life. The assessment can take place in person or via video calls.

The psychiatrist will give the patient a written report after an ADHD assessment. The report will include the diagnosis and treatment recommendations. The psychiatrist will also talk about the medications that may be prescribed.

If you've been diagnosed with ADHD it is crucial to be aware that the medication may cause side effects and addiction. The psychiatrist will monitor your progress and make adjustments to your dosage if needed. This process can take some time but you should keep in mind that your psychiatrist will not try to rush anything.

BBC's Panorama program has highlighted the issues people have in obtaining an NHS ADHD diagnosis. In the past, it could be very difficult to get a diagnosis in the absence of funds or access to private clinics. Now, however, the NHS allows patients to access private assessments through its 'Right to Choose process, which makes it much easier to obtain an accurate diagnosis.

While the program does highlight the shortcomings of private adhd assessment reading clinics it also reveals that the NHS is struggling to cope with demand for ADHD assessments. The NHS constitution stipulates that a person is entitled to an assessment within 18 weeks of a referral from your doctor. However, waiting times are at record levels. Those who can't wait are faced with a choice: continue to suffer with no diagnosis or pay for a privately conducted assessment.

Clinical assessment

The NHS is currently struggling to provide enough mental health services for adults suffering from ADHD. This results in long wait times to be diagnosed and treatment. This impacts the quality of life of people. Some people are denied treatment because of the high demand for services. This is an issue because people with undiagnosed ADHD may have significant issues at home or at work, as well as in their relationships. Fortunately, there are a number of Private ADHD assessment Bristol cost clinics that offer ADHD assessments. These assessments are often performed via phone or online video chat, which means it doesn't require a trip to a psychiatrist's office.

Adult ADHD assessment consists of an interview and questionnaires. It also includes a review of past behavior and current problems. The psychiatric professional will determine if you suffer from ADHD, and how it affects your daily functioning. The psychiatric specialist will provide you a written report and discuss possible treatments. The cost of an ADHD assessment typically ranges from PS750 and PS1000.

ADHD tests are conducted by trained Psychiatrists or Clinical Nurse Specialists. They will evaluate your symptoms and behavior in various settings, such as at home, at school and at work. In some instances, they may recommend cognitive therapies or other medications. These treatments can help manage your symptoms and improve your performance in all aspects of your life.

Psychiatry-UK is a leading provider of NHS-funded ADHD assessments and treatment for adults in England. They have contracts with a variety of Integrated Care Boards and NHS Trusts. They have access to NICE guidelines, so they can offer a high standard of assessment. They can also assist with financing through Right To Choose if you are denied a referral by your GP.

The cost of an adult ADHD assessment includes an online or face-to-face video consultation as well as a diagnostic interview and the report written. The report can be shared by your GP. In addition, the price of an ADHD assessment includes prescription for ADHD medication if needed. The assessment also includes correspondence with your GP whilst you are titrated and stabilised on medication.

Medication

There are a variety of medications that can be used to treat ADHD. The GP and psychiatrists typically prescribe these. They can boost motivation as well as focus and concentration. These medications may also cause negative side effects. It is important that you discuss these side effects with your doctor. They may suggest a lower dose or a different medication.

There is also a chance of addiction and overdose from these medications. These medications should be taken as directed by your GP or psychiatrist. They shouldn't be stopped suddenly or after long periods of time. If you are taking these medicines for a prolonged period of time, it is crucial to have regular follow-up appointments. You should also be on the lookout for your heart rate and blood pressure and consult your GP if you have any concerns.

The relegation of adult ADHD diagnosis treatment and monitoring to specialist tertiary or secondary services is incompatible with its prevalence and its long-term effects. It is an utter waste of NHS money, and it results in poor outcomes for the individual and the economic system. It also stigmatizes those with the condition.

The BBC's investigation into private clinics that give out inaccurate diagnoses of ADHD has exposed the glaring inconsistency between demand and capacity for services on the NHS. The NHS simply does not have enough trained specialists to meet the demand.

There are long waiting lists for NHS assessment and treatment. The government says it will work to improve access to adult ADHD services in its Green Paper on special educational needs and alternative provision.

In the meantime there are a variety of organisations that provide adult ADHD assessments and treatment. Psychiatry-UK for instance, has contracts with Integrated Care Boards (ICBC) and NHS England that allow it to assess and prescribe ADHD treatments in England.

A typical patient journey that includes a diagnosis evaluation and written report, as well as regular follow-up appointments and the letter of shared care to your doctor, costs between PS1200-PS2000. This does not include any prescribed non-ADHD medication. This does not include prescriptions not needed in follow up appointments.

Follow-up

Private ADHD assessment costs vary depending on the service. The price of private ADHD assessments can be as low as PS500 to PS800 and includes consultations lasting up to an hour. They also include a medication evaluation to ensure that you are taking the correct dosage. Some providers offer online video and phone follow-up packages.

ADHD specialists are highly trained to identify adults suffering from the condition. They will review your medical history, your family history, as well as your symptoms to determine whether you suffer from ADHD. They may recommend psychotherapy, or a combination of medication and therapy. Many people seek out Private Adhd Assessment cost diagnosis due to the fact that they cannot get an appointment with a doctor and the NHS has incredibly long waiting times.

The primary goal of the ADHD assessment is to determine if you suffer from other mental health problems. If you do, it's crucial to discuss them with your psychiatrist. This will help your psychiatrist determine the best treatment option for you. The cost of an ADHD evaluation can be expensive however it is worth it to get the best treatment.

It is essential to find a psychiatrist who has had experience treating adults with ADHD. This is because adult ADHD is often misdiagnosed and poorly treated. If not treated, ADHD can lead to serious issues, like depression or anxiety. In addition, they may not be able to perform effectively at work or in relationships.

Private services are used by a few families and individuals with ADHD to prevent gaps or obstructions in public health care. These services do not guarantee the accuracy of clinical reports and assessments they provide. Additionally, they don't always comply with the guidelines of the National Institute for Clinical Excellence.

There are also concerns that certain private healthcare providers capitalize on the desperation of help-seeking patients but do not conduct thorough ADHD evaluations. They might not be aware of the complex nature of ADHD or have a preconceived view of the disorder. This has led to sporadic stories of children suffering from significant comorbidities being denied access to medical care, or even denied the diagnosis of ADHD.
